The HC granted the writ petition, directing provisional release of the impugned second-hand digital multifunction devices (MFDs) subject to conditions under the Customs Act, 1962. Relying on precedent that MFDs prima facie qualify as highly specialised equipment (HSEs) and are provisionally releasable, the court ordered the Customs authority at Chennai to pass orders for provisional release within four weeks and to release the goods within two weeks after the petitioner fulfils imposed conditions. The HC rejected the respondents' contention that the goods are conclusively restricted or prohibited at the provisional stage. The petition is disposed of.
